1.The value of Duke treadmill score in coronary heart disease
Chinese Journal of Primary Medicine and Pharmacy 2015;22(4):551-553
Objective To discuss the value of Duke treadmill score in the diagnosis of coronary heart disease.Methods 94 inpatients underwent treadmill test and coronary angiography,the relationship between the Duke treadmill score and the results of coronary angiography was analyzed.Results The prognostic accuracy and positive predictive value of Duke treadmill score to male and female were 88.9%,85.0% ;those of traditional electrocardiogram ST standard were 89.6%,82.5 %,the differences were significant (x2 =4.27,P < 0.05).Conclusion The Duke treadmill score is much more significant than the traditional ST standard in the prognostic accuracy and positive predictive value of diagnosing coronary heart disease.

4.Influence of Baduanjin on mild cognitive impairment in elderly diabetic patients
Huimin ZHU ; Ning ZHANG ; Cheng JI
Chinese Journal of Practical Nursing 2015;31(16):1202-1204
Objective To explore the influence of Chinese Qigong--Baduanjin on mild cognitive impairment (MCI) in elderly diabetic patients.Methods A total of 78 elderly type 2 diabetic patients complicated with MCI were divided into intervention group and control group by random digits table method.The control group with 41 patients was received routine treatment and discharged guidance after discharging from hospital.The intervention group with 37 patients was received Baduanjin exercise for 12 months based on the routine treatment in control group.Montreal Cognitive Assessment (MoCA) and Activity of Daily Living (ADL) scores in two groups were compared before intervention and 1,3,6,9 and 12 months after intervention.Results In intervention group,MoCA scores were significantly increased at different times after intervention compared with those before intervention,F=72.782,the differences were statistically significant,P<0.05.At the same time,MoCA scores were all significantly higher in intervention group than those in control group,F=2.231,2.972,4.362,5.085,5.373,the differences were statistically significant,P< 0.05.In intervention group,ADL scores had significantly improved since 6 months after intervention compared with those before intervention,F=93.126,the differences were statistically significant,P<0.05,and compared with those in control group,the scores were significantly higher since 6 months after intervention,F=3.853,4.561,7.162,the differences were statistically significant,P<0.05.Conclusion Chinese Qigong--Baduanjin in treatment of elderly diabetic patients complicated with MCI can delay the MCI progress and improve ADL of the patients.
5.Effect of Cluster Needling of Scalp Acupuncture Combined with Rehabilitation on Depression after Stroke following Motor Aphasia
Huimin ZHANG ; Qiang TANG ; Luwen ZHU
Chinese Journal of Rehabilitation Theory and Practice 2011;17(4):319-321
ObjectiveTo explore the effect of cluster needling of scalp acupuncture combined with rehabilitation(Tang's Approach) on depression of stroke patients with motor aphasia.Methods70 stroke patients were randomly divided into the acupuncture with rehabilitation group and the control group. The cluster needle of scalp point with speech rehabilitation training was used in the acupuncture with rehabilitation group, while speech rehabilitation training was used only in the control group. The degree of depression and aphasia were observed in the two groups 4 weeks after treament.Results 4 weeks after the treatment, the classification of aphasia was getting better in the acupuncture with rehabilitation group than in the control group(P<0.05), and the incidence of depression decreased significantly in the acupuncture with rehabilitation group compared with the control group(P<0.01). The score of Stroke Aphasic Depression Scale (SADQ) decreased significantly in the acupuncture with rehabilitation group compared with the control group (P<0.01).ConclusionTang's Approach may improve the depression of stroke patients with motor aphasia.
6.Study the effects of losartan on brain natriuretic peptide and C-reactive protein in diabetic cardiomyopathy patients
Ziqing ZHU ; Shijie CHENG ; Huimin YING
Chinese Journal of Postgraduates of Medicine 2011;34(7):28-30
Objective To explore the effects oflosartan on brain natriuretic peptide(BNP)and C-reactive protein(CLRP)in diabetic cardiomyopathy patients. Methods Sixty diabetics were divided into diabetic control group(30 cases)and diabetic cardiomyopathy group(30 cases), and the levels of BNP and CRP in plasma were determined. Then, diabetic cardiomyopathy group were divided into conventional treatment group(15 cases)and losartan treatment group(15 cases)by random digits table to take corresponding treatment for 12 weeks. The changes of cardiac function, the levels of BNP and CRP in plasma were detected and compared. Results The levels of BNP and CRP in diabetic cardiomyopathy group [(331.27 ±65.64)ng/L,(26.10±10.13)mg/L]were significantly higher than those in diabetic control group[(76.09±39.14)ng/L,(7.03±2.71)mg/L](P<0.01). After treatment 12 weeks, the levels of BNP and CRP were significantly lower, left ventricular ejection fraction was significantly higher and left ventricular end-diastolic diameter was significantly lower in losartan treatment group than those in conventional treatment group(P<0.05).Conclusions The increasing levels of BNP and CRP can reflect clinical severity of diabetic cardiomyopathy.Losartan can decrease the levels of BNP and CRP, and improve heart function, and it has better effective on diabetic cardiomyopathy.
7.Stability Study of Tramadol,Fentanyl and Ondansetron Combined with 0.9% Sodium Chloride Injection in Analgesia Pump
Wen CHEN ; Baoxia FANG ; Huimin LIU ; Fuchao CHEN ; Jun ZHU
China Pharmacy 2016;27(8):1048-1050
OBJECTIVE:To study the stability of Tramadol hydrochloride,Fentanyl citrate and Ondansetron hydrochloride in-jection in 0.9% Sodium chloride injection. METHODS:At room temperature [(25±1)℃],three injections were poured into infu-sion bag of disposable analgesia pump,and diluted with 0.9% Sodium chloride injection. The changes in precipitation,turbidity, color and pH value of the mixture were observed. The relative percentage of three injections within 72 h were determined by HPLC method. RESULTS:There was no significant change in the pH value and appearance of the mixture. Relative percentage of tramad-ol hydrochloride,fentanyl citrate and ondansetron hydrochloride were all higher than 97% within 72 h. CONCLUSIONS:The mix-ture of Tramadol hydrochloride,Fentanyl citrate and Ondansetron hydrochloride injection in 0.9% Sodium chloride injection keep stable within 72 h under room temperature.
8.Effect of 3 isoforms of Ikaros on proliferation of human ovarian cancer SKOV3 cells
Licai HE ; Shang CHEN ; Zhenfeng ZHU ; Jun GAN ; Huimin YU
Chinese Journal of Pathophysiology 2015;(8):1407-1411
AIM:ToinvestigatetheeffectofIkarosisoformsontheproliferationofhumanovariancancerSK-OV3 cells.METHODS:Three isoforms of Ikaros, IK1, IK2 and IK6, were transfected into ovarian cancer SKOV3 cells. CCK-8 assay and cell counting were used to detect the effects of Ikaros isoforms on the proliferation of SKOV 3 cells.The cell cycle was analyzed by flow cytometry .The cell cycle-related proteins were detected by Western blot .RESULTS:IK1 and IK2 expression inhibited SKOV 3 cells proliferation .Flow cytometry analysis indicated that IK 1 and IK2 induced SK-OV3 cell cycle arrest at the G 1 phase.IK6 isoform exerted no obvious effect on the proliferation or cell cycle of SKOV 3 cells.Compared with control EV group , IK1 group and IK2 group showed a dramatic elevation in the expression of the cell cycle inhibitor p21, along with a substantial decrease in the expression of the cell cycle inducers cyclin D 1 and cyclin D2, which did not change in IK 6 group.CONCLUSION:IK1 and IK2 significantly inhibit the proliferation of ovarian cancer SKOV3 cells and induce cell cycle arrest at G 1 phase by regulation of cell cycle-related proteins cyclin D1, cyclin D2 and p21, while IK6 isoform exerts no obvious effect on the proliferation and cell cycle of SKOV 3 cells.
9.Effect of Radix Paeoniae Bubra on NADPH oxidase p22phox,MCP-1 mRNA expression and neointimal hyperplasia after balloon injury in cholesterol-fed rabbits
Huimin ZHU ; Jinxiu FAN ; Han SHI ; Ya CHEN
China Journal of Traditional Chinese Medicine and Pharmacy 2005;0(11):-
Objective:To observe the effect of Radix Paeoniae Bubra(RPB)on NADPH oxidase p22phox,monocyte chemotactic protein-1(MCP-1)mRNA expression and neointimal hyperplasia after carotid artery balloon injury in cholesterol-fed rabbits.Methods:The rabbit model of carotid balloon injury was established adopting Clowes method,and treated with extract of RPB.Component of neointima and expression of proliferating cell nuclear antigen(PCNA)and macrophage was determined by immunochemical stain.The collagen of typeⅠwas detected by special staining for blood vessels and the area of neointima was measured by image assay system.Expression of NADPH oxidase p22phox mRNA,MCP-1 mRNA was detected by in situ hybridization and transcription-polymerase chain reaction.Results:RPB can attenuate the neointima area and proliferation of collagen typeⅠinduced by balloon-injury,remarkable prevent the formation of restenosi,and down-regulate expression of NADPH oxidase p22 and MCP-1mRNA significantly and decrease the degree of macrophages infiltration especially in vessel wall of injuring carotid artery.Conclusions:RPB inhibited NADPH oxidase P22Phox and MCP-1 mRNA expression,and modestly reduced neointimal hyperplasia,which might be partly attributed to its antioxidant and inflammatory effects.
